Cuyamaca Indian Legend
There is a lovely Indian legend about the
Cuyamaca Mountains.
A great many years ago all of the mountain
peaks lived happily together. Mountains could talk, you know, and so
they talked and laughed together. Later they began to quarrel.
Corte Madera was the littlest mountain peak.
He was very timid. He did not want to quarrel so he took a few of the
pine trees and chokeberry bushes and went off by himself.
Mt. Laguna was a big strong mountain peak,
but he felt that he was being pushed. So he took some trees and went
off by himself to set up his kingdom. He took pine trees and cedar trees
and chokeberry bushes, but he went away in such a hurry that he didn't
take any of the fir trees.
So Cuyamaca is the only mountain in that
area that has many fir trees.
